Frequently Asked Questions
Will a rubber-backed rug pad scratch my glazed tile?
Quality felt + rubber pads are designed to avoid scratching when installed correctly (felt side up, rubber grid down). Avoid sticky adhesive pads or pads with aggressive backing on delicate glazed finishes. Test a small corner first if your tile has an especially soft or coated finish.
Which side of the pad faces the floor?
For felt + rubber pads, rubber (the grid side) should contact the floor to provide traction; the felt side faces the rug to cushion and protect rug fibers.
Can I trim these pads to fit my rug?
Yes — the pads reviewed are designed to be trimmed with household scissors so you can customize the shape and size. Lay the rug over the pad, trace the outline, then cut slightly inside the line for a neat fit.
